Onboarding note for the Ledgerpane admin table: bulk edits are applied through the batcher service, not directly against the database. Select rows, choose an action, and the batcher stages changes in a pending set you can review before commit. Edits over 500 rows require a second approver — this is enforced server-side, so don't try to chunk around it. To run the batcher locally you need the staging write credential, which goes in your .env as the next line.

secret setting of bahip-kagag: RELAY_SECRET3=c83

Graphlume runbook — plugin authors. If node layout stalls on graphs over 5k edges, disable incremental relayout in your plugin manifest and let the Corvass engine batch it. Check that your edge provider returns stable IDs; unstable IDs force full recomputes. Clear the local layout cache before retesting. Report failures against the engine snapshot identified by the token below.

trace token, kahog-tajeg: htk6_97d963

## Artifact Signing — TilePull Prefetcher

Every TilePull release artifact is signed before it reaches the distribution bucket. As a contractor, you won't sign builds yourself; the pipeline does it automatically after tests pass. You only need to verify downloads against the published key during local testing. The current verification key for TilePull artifacts is shown here.

release key, hadug-kawef: bky13_mPGeFZeR1GZ1G